I have been running clamav as part of my mailer's anti-spam system for years. More recently I started using the Debian package rather that a self-build (mainly because clamav requires an increase of support code) but I am having trouble starting it. In particular it reports Starting ClamAV daemon: Tue Aug 9 16:36:00 2022 -> !LOCAL: Socket file /var/run/clamav/clamd could not be bound: Permission denied Tue Aug 9 16:36:00 2022 -> *Closing the main socket. I have tried changing ownership/permissions on /var/run/clamav with no noticeable affect. In the past I had to change ownership to Debian-exim but that does not seem sufficient. What should I do next?
